The Wollemi Pine Global Launch
..............................

The Wollemi Pine was launched with a special exhibition at the Royal Botanic Gardens Sydney, from October 14-23. The secret grove of jurassic Wollemi Pines that was discovered in the Blue Mountains 11 years ago was recreated with around 100 of the first cultivated trees. The exhibition culminated in the first release of a limited number of the coveted Pines at an international Sotheby's auction held on site on October 23.

The launch and auction was a great success and a fitting tribute to 11 years of research and conservation work. Thousands of Wollemi enthusiasts visited the "Wollemi Pine Wilderness Unveiled" exhibition and the auction was unprecedented with 100% of the 292 trees sold and over A$1,000,000 raised.

The highlight of the auction was the A$150,000 paid for the "Sir Joseph Banks Collection", a selection of 15 trees with each tree grown from one of all the 15 original trees in the wild from which cuttings were taken. The average price for a single tree was approximately A$3,600.

The sale also raised significant funds for a number of conservation organisations in Australia and internationally, in particular the A$26,000 raised for the Royal Botanic Gardens Sydney and A$14,000 for the Blue Mountains World Heritage Institute.

The "Wollemi Pine Wilderness Unveiled Exhibit" was designed by Australia's pre-eminent urban design and landscape architecture firm, EDAW Gillespies, with the construction managed by multi award winning landscape design and construction company, Above the Earth. Together with the timber boardwalk provided by Landmark and the support of Galuku (a distributor of premium cocopeat products) and other generous industry sponsors, the Exhibit was a tribute to the natural setting of the Pines in the Blue Mountains and their prehistoric past.

2006 Release:
A range of smaller Wollemi Pine pot plants for your home, garden or patio will be available from April 2006 at selected garden centres, online and via mail and phone order.
